Has anybody else experienced Pandora skipping an crackling since the move to 2.2.1?

I at first had it loaded on my SD card and thought maybe that was it.
Still didnt fix it when I moved it to my phone.

Then I uninstalled and reinstalled. Still happened.
I also checked to make sure what settings that Pandora was on.... It was on lower quality just like I always had it on when I had 2.1

I also tried going to manage applications and clearing the cache and force stopping it. No dice.

Pandora does say if you have it on higer quality you may recieve skipping and popping but i didnt have it on that setting.

I have this same problem intermittently and as of yet have not been able to pinpoint the source of the crackling/skipping/popping.

It does it regardless of signal strength or wifi connection status.
It does it regardless of SetCPU clock settings (thought that my low frequency battery saver settings might have done it)
It does it with the screen on with me actively using the phone
It does it with the screen off
It does it standing still
It does it driving

Yet with all of these, the crackling is 100% random and goes away once the affected song is skipped... only to return a few songs later. It also seems that if the song starts with crackling it will crackle for the entirety of the song (ie: pausing and waiting for it to buffer does nothing).

All in all it is a minor inconvenience, Pandora is still very usable... just more annoying than anything.
